The Fulfilment Coordinator supports in managing the day-to-day operational functions for the Logistics Center departments and in the most cost-effective manner while meeting the needs of both the internal and external customer. Requires excellent communication skills and the ability to independently evaluate and problem solve during the course of the day.  Reports directly to the Operations Supervisor.

Key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Supervision and Training: Oversee, train, and provide performance feedback to direct reports, ensuring high productivity, efficiency, and effectiveness. Monitoring and mentoring of associates on productivity, quality and safety.

  • Operational Management: Manage incoming and outgoing shipments, organize merchandise, and maintain accurate warehouse inventory. 

  • Production Planning: Develop production schedules and allocate resources to ensure timely completion of job assignments, while maintaining records of time and production.

  • Activity Monitoring/Reporting: Track and send operational reports to designated operation personnel to inform decision-making.

Additional Duties and Responsibilities

  • Monitor and correct at-risk behaviors.

  • Recognize and reward positive behaviors.

  • Ability to work in a fast paced environment.

  • Manage performance to ensure required levels of productivity and organizational objectives are met.

  • Employee Relations: Address employee issues and foster open communication across all levels of the organization.

  • Maintain and implement plans to maintain productivity, safety standards, quality, cost control, and employee morale.

  • Working knowledge of computerized applications (word processing, spreadsheet, database, presentation software, email).


Minimum Requirements:

Experience: Minimum of 1-2 years in warehouse or logistics leadership, with specific experience in warehouse fulfillment or e-commerce management involving onsite ordering, picking, packing, and shipping.

  • Metrics: Skills monitoring teams daily production goals and dynamically meeting company KPIs.

  • WMS Familiarity: Experience in using Warehouse Management Systems (WMS).

  • Conflict Management: Skills in resolving conflicts and managing team dynamics.

  • Physical Requirements: Capable of lifting at least 40 lbs; weight may vary based on facility requirements. Frequent walking, carrying, reaching, standing, and stooping.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
